Former Love Island contestant Jacques O'Neill has taken to Twitter to announce that he is mental health is now in a better place.
The 23-year-old shocked fans of the hit ITV2 dating show when he decided to leave earlier this month following the return of bombshell Adam Collard the previous day.
Jacques' final scenes aired on 12 July and showed him tearfully telling Paige Thorne, with whom he coupled up with, he would want to make her his girlfriend once she left the show.
In the days that followed, the 24-year-old paramedic has moved on with Adam.

Since leaving the villa, Jacques has been inundated with positive messages from fans after his exit and he has now thanked viewers while also providing an update about his state of mind.
Sharing a picture of himself out and about, Jacques said: "I just want you all to know that I’m in such a better place mentally. A huge reason for that is because of all the love and support I have received! I’d be in a much darker place if it wasn’t for all of your kind words, so thank you again I appreciate it so much."

Following his departure, Jacques made a guest appearance on Love Island: Aftersun (17 July) where he was asked by host Laura Whitmore about Paige seemingly moving on with Adam and their first kiss.

He reminded Laura that before he left the show, he told Paige to 'crack on' and he said that while he did believe the pair had a connection, he was happy to see her doing what she needed to do.
